BILL NUMBER: S617
SPONSOR: COMRIE
 
TITLE OF BILL:
An act to amend the vehicle and traffic law, in relation to requiring
that all for-hire vehicles have New York state license plates in order
to receive a New York state inspection
 
PURPOSE OR GENERAL IDEA OF BILL:
This legislation would require all for-hire vehicles must have New York
State license plates in order to receive a New York State inspection
 
SUMMARY OF PROVISIONS:
Section 1 of the bill amends section 301 of the vehicle and traffic law
to require all for-hire vehicles with 9 or more passengers receive a New
York State Department of Transportation inspection only if they have a
New York State license plate, and sets forth definitions to that end.
Section 2 of the bill provides the effective date.
 
JUSTIFICATION:
There are hundreds of for-hire vehicles operating across New York state
that receive annual New York State inspections with out of state plates.
Often, the vehicles are owned and operated by New York State residents
or entities who are able to register in states like New Jersey, Connec-
ticut, Pennsylvania or Vermont despite the bulk of their business trans-
actions taking place in New York. This is done to take advantage of
cheaper insurance and registration rates.
A consequence of this is a loss to vehicles in the insurance pool within
the for-hire economy here in New York. That drives up costs for everyone
else that maintain New York state registration and insurance. This bill
is an option to remedy that.
